A classification essay is a type of academic writing that organizes and categorizes ideas or objects into specific groups or categories. The purpose of this type of essay is to provide a clear and logical structure for presenting information, making it easier for the reader to understand and process.

There are many different ways to write a classification essay, and the specific approach will depend on the topic and the purpose of the essay. However, there are a few common elements that are typically included in this type of essay.

One of the key elements of a classification essay is the use of clear and concise categories or groups. These categories should be based on a logical principle, such as shared characteristics or common features. It is important to ensure that the categories are mutually exclusive and exhaustive, meaning that they should cover all of the possible options and not overlap with one another.

Another important element of a classification essay is the use of examples to support and illustrate the categories. These examples should be relevant and specific, and they should help to clarify and reinforce the points being made in the essay.

Here are a few examples of classification essay topics and the categories that could be used to organize the information:

  1. Types of pets: This topic could be organized into categories such as dogs, cats, birds, small mammals, and reptiles. Each category could include examples of different breeds or species within that group.

  2. Forms of transportation: This topic could be organized into categories such as cars, buses, trains, planes, and bikes. Each category could include examples of different types of vehicles within that group, such as different makes and models of cars.

  3. Types of music: This topic could be organized into categories such as rock, pop, hip hop, classical, and jazz. Each category could include examples of different artists or styles within that group.

Overall, a classification essay is a useful tool for organizing and presenting information in a clear and logical way. By using clear categories and relevant examples, it is possible to effectively convey complex ideas and information to the reader.
